The Benefits of Using a Tripod for Mirrorless Cameras

If you’re a mirrorless camera user, you know that having a tripod is essential for capturing the perfect shot. But why is that? What are the benefits of using a tripod for mirrorless cameras? Let’s take a look.

First and foremost, a tripod helps to keep your camera steady. This is especially important when shooting in low light or when using a long exposure. With a tripod, you can be sure that your camera won’t move, resulting in sharper images.

Second, a tripod allows you to take advantage of the full range of your camera’s features. With a tripod, you can use the full range of shutter speeds, ISO settings, and other features that your camera offers. This means that you can get the most out of your camera and capture the best possible images.

Third, a tripod can help you to capture unique angles and perspectives. With a tripod, you can easily adjust the height and angle of your camera to get the perfect shot. This is especially useful for landscape photography, where you may need to capture a unique angle or perspective.

Finally, a tripod can help you to take better photos in general. With a tripod, you can take your time to compose the perfect shot and make sure that everything is in focus. This can help you to capture the best possible images and get the most out of your camera.

As you can see, there are many benefits to using a tripod for mirrorless cameras. From keeping your camera steady to capturing unique angles and perspectives, a tripod can help you to take better photos and get the most out of your camera. Q&A

1. What are the benefits of using a tripod for mirrorless cameras?
A: The main benefit of using a tripod for mirrorless cameras is that it helps to keep the camera steady and reduce camera shake, which can lead to sharper images. Additionally, a tripod can help to keep the camera in the same position for multiple shots, making it easier to capture a series of images with the same composition.

2. What features should I look for when choosing a tripod for my mirrorless camera?
A: When choosing a tripod for your mirrorless camera, you should look for a model that is lightweight and compact, yet still sturdy enough to support your camera. Additionally, look for a tripod with adjustable legs and a ball head, which will allow you to easily adjust the angle of the camera.

3. Are there any special considerations I should make when using a tripod with a mirrorless camera?
A: Yes, when using a tripod with a mirrorless camera, you should make sure that the tripod is compatible with the camera’s weight and size. Additionally, you should make sure that the tripod is stable and secure, as any movement can cause camera shake and blur your images.

4. What is the best type of tripod for mirrorless cameras?
A: The best type of tripod for mirrorless cameras is a lightweight, compact model with adjustable legs and a ball head. This type of tripod will provide the stability and flexibility needed to capture sharp images with your mirrorless camera.

5. Are there any tips for using a tripod with a mirrorless camera?
A: Yes, when using a tripod with a mirrorless camera, make sure to use the tripod’s ball head to adjust the angle of the camera. Additionally, make sure to use the tripod’s locking mechanism to secure the camera in place, and use a remote shutter release or timer to reduce camera shake.
